Price is great at $159.00 but quality of the bells is poor. Although they look good, the pitch isn't consistent and some bigger bells have a pitch higher than others four bells away. I think it has something to do with the thickness of each bell. The thinner the bell, the lower the pitch. Also some bells have a nice sustain in the ringing, others do not.

But... mounting bar does not come set with best installation, bolts on clamp were installed backwards, and clamp does not come with washers and rubber plate needed to keep unit from sliding down a poll. Suggest altering rubber washers and brass sleeve positioning so tree is evenly spaced on the stand. If you look at the photo above you'll see there is too much space at the top of the rod and all the rubber washers are at the top. If you split them up and move two rubber sets to bottom, the tree is centered better and has beneficial rubber washers above and below.
